Specialist Positions. Specialist Positions fill special needs within the department. Examples of special needs include the following: • Specialized knowledge, skills, or abilities • Long-term commitment to a program or course to ensure consistency • Teaching at a remote site • Teaching in a program with a schedule different from the regular quarterly schedule • Client-driven programs Specialist Positions have a fixed duration. Holders of a Specialist Position may re-apply for the position at the end of their term. In the event of a downturn in enrollment in a program where there is more than one Specialist Position holder, the holders will be removed from the assignment in reverse order of initial assignment date to the position. If more than one holder has the same assignment date, the removal will be based on their date listed on the Work Assignment Roster (Article 9). If enrollments increase, the Specialist Position holders will be brought back to complete their initial assignments in reverse order of removal.

  • Specialists Persons working within a juridical person who possess uncommon knowledge essential to the commercial presence’s production, research equipment, techniques or management. In assessing such knowledge, account will be taken not only of knowledge specific to the commercial presence, but also of whether the person has a high level of qualification referring to a type of work or trade requiring specific technical knowledge, including membership of an accredited profession.
